從"混亂開(kāi)發(fā)"到"高效落地":軟件研發(fā)管理如何重塑企業(yè)技術(shù)力?
在數(shù)字經(jīng)濟(jì)浪潮下,軟件已成為企業(yè)連接用戶(hù)、優(yōu)化流程、創(chuàng)新業(yè)務(wù)的核心載體。從一個(gè)想法到上線(xiàn)運(yùn)行,一款軟件的誕生需要經(jīng)歷需求拆解、代碼編寫(xiě)、測(cè)試驗(yàn)證、部署維護(hù)等數(shù)十個(gè)環(huán)節(jié)。然而,當(dāng)團(tuán)隊(duì)規(guī)模擴(kuò)大、項(xiàng)目復(fù)雜度提升時(shí),"資源分配不合理""需求反復(fù)變更""進(jìn)度延遲卻找不到問(wèn)題根源"等現(xiàn)象頻繁出現(xiàn)——這正是缺乏系統(tǒng)化軟件研發(fā)管理的典型表現(xiàn)。
一、軟件研發(fā)管理:技術(shù)落地的"中樞神經(jīng)"到底管什么?
簡(jiǎn)單來(lái)說(shuō),軟件研發(fā)管理是貫穿軟件全生命周期的"統(tǒng)籌者",它通過(guò)科學(xué)的方法和工具,將開(kāi)發(fā)團(tuán)隊(duì)、技術(shù)資源、時(shí)間成本等要素有機(jī)整合,確保項(xiàng)目在預(yù)定軌道上運(yùn)行。根據(jù)行業(yè)實(shí)踐,其核心覆蓋七大維度:
- 團(tuán)隊(duì)建設(shè):明確角色分工(如產(chǎn)品經(jīng)理、開(kāi)發(fā)工程師、測(cè)試人員),建立協(xié)作規(guī)則,提升成員技術(shù)能力與溝通效率;
- 流程設(shè)計(jì):規(guī)劃從需求分析到上線(xiàn)維護(hù)的全流程節(jié)點(diǎn),常見(jiàn)模型包括瀑布模型(分階段推進(jìn))、敏捷開(kāi)發(fā)(小步快跑迭代)等;
- 績(jī)效管理:設(shè)定可量化的目標(biāo)(如代碼提交頻率、測(cè)試通過(guò)率),通過(guò)數(shù)據(jù)評(píng)估團(tuán)隊(duì)與個(gè)人貢獻(xiàn);
- 成本管理:監(jiān)控人力、服務(wù)器、工具授權(quán)等開(kāi)支,避免資源浪費(fèi);
- 風(fēng)險(xiǎn)管理:識(shí)別技術(shù)瓶頸(如第三方庫(kù)兼容性)、人員流失等潛在風(fēng)險(xiǎn),制定應(yīng)對(duì)預(yù)案;
- 知識(shí)管理:沉淀需求文檔、代碼規(guī)范、問(wèn)題解決方案等資產(chǎn),避免重復(fù)踩坑;
- 質(zhì)量控制:通過(guò)代碼審查、自動(dòng)化測(cè)試、性能監(jiān)控等手段,確保交付成果符合預(yù)期標(biāo)準(zhǔn)。
舉個(gè)實(shí)際例子:某互聯(lián)網(wǎng)公司開(kāi)發(fā)電商APP時(shí),初期因未明確需求邊界,開(kāi)發(fā)中途頻繁新增"直播帶貨""會(huì)員積分"等功能,導(dǎo)致開(kāi)發(fā)周期延長(zhǎng)2個(gè)月,服務(wù)器成本超支30%。引入研發(fā)管理后,團(tuán)隊(duì)通過(guò)需求評(píng)審會(huì)鎖定核心功能,采用敏捷迭代分階段交付,最終不僅提前1周上線(xiàn),還通過(guò)復(fù)用歷史模塊降低了20%的開(kāi)發(fā)成本。
二、研發(fā)亂象背后的三大痛點(diǎn):為什么說(shuō)管理是"必選項(xiàng)"?
盡管軟件研發(fā)管理的價(jià)值顯著,但許多企業(yè)仍處于"被動(dòng)管理"狀態(tài)。通過(guò)調(diào)研行業(yè)案例,我們總結(jié)出三大典型痛點(diǎn):
(一)資源利用像"黑箱",優(yōu)化無(wú)據(jù)可依
某金融科技公司曾遇到這樣的問(wèn)題:研發(fā)部門(mén)申請(qǐng)了20臺(tái)云服務(wù)器,但實(shí)際使用率不足40%;測(cè)試團(tuán)隊(duì)抱怨設(shè)備不夠用,卻發(fā)現(xiàn)部分設(shè)備長(zhǎng)期閑置。由于缺乏資源監(jiān)控機(jī)制,管理者既無(wú)法判斷資源需求的合理性,也難以推動(dòng)跨團(tuán)隊(duì)的資源共享。數(shù)據(jù)顯示,65%的企業(yè)存在不同程度的資源浪費(fèi),根源正是資源使用情況不透明。
(二)項(xiàng)目信息"碎片化",問(wèn)題溯源靠"猜"
在傳統(tǒng)開(kāi)發(fā)模式中,需求文檔存放在產(chǎn)品經(jīng)理的本地電腦,代碼提交記錄分散在各個(gè)開(kāi)發(fā)者的Git倉(cāng)庫(kù),測(cè)試報(bào)告由測(cè)試團(tuán)隊(duì)單獨(dú)保管。當(dāng)項(xiàng)目延期時(shí),管理者需要逐一詢(xún)問(wèn)相關(guān)人員,才能拼湊出"需求變更未同步開(kāi)發(fā)""某模塊測(cè)試阻塞"等真實(shí)原因。這種信息孤島現(xiàn)象,導(dǎo)致問(wèn)題定位效率降低40%以上,嚴(yán)重影響項(xiàng)目進(jìn)度。
(三)風(fēng)險(xiǎn)應(yīng)對(duì)"靠經(jīng)驗(yàn)",關(guān)鍵節(jié)點(diǎn)易"爆雷"
某醫(yī)療軟件企業(yè)開(kāi)發(fā)電子病歷系統(tǒng)時(shí),因未提前評(píng)估第三方支付接口的穩(wěn)定性,上線(xiàn)后頻繁出現(xiàn)支付失敗問(wèn)題,不僅影響用戶(hù)體驗(yàn),還面臨監(jiān)管部門(mén)的合規(guī)檢查。這類(lèi)風(fēng)險(xiǎn)事件的發(fā)生,往往是因?yàn)槠髽I(yè)依賴(lài)"過(guò)往經(jīng)驗(yàn)"而非系統(tǒng)化的風(fēng)險(xiǎn)評(píng)估流程。數(shù)據(jù)顯示,78%的軟件項(xiàng)目曾因未識(shí)別關(guān)鍵風(fēng)險(xiǎn)導(dǎo)致延期或成本超支。
三、從理論到實(shí)踐:軟件研發(fā)管理的四大核心模塊
要破解上述痛點(diǎn),需聚焦研發(fā)管理的四大核心模塊,構(gòu)建覆蓋全流程的管理體系。
(一)流程管理:讓開(kāi)發(fā)過(guò)程"可預(yù)測(cè)、可控制"
流程是研發(fā)管理的"骨架"。以敏捷開(kāi)發(fā)為例,其核心是將項(xiàng)目拆解為2-4周的"迭代周期",每個(gè)周期包含需求確認(rèn)、開(kāi)發(fā)、測(cè)試、評(píng)審四個(gè)環(huán)節(jié)。通過(guò)每日站會(huì)同步進(jìn)度,迭代結(jié)束時(shí)交付可運(yùn)行的功能模塊,既能快速響應(yīng)需求變化,又能通過(guò)階段性成果驗(yàn)證降低整體風(fēng)險(xiǎn)。某教育SaaS企業(yè)引入敏捷流程后,需求變更響應(yīng)時(shí)間從7天縮短至1天,客戶(hù)滿(mǎn)意度提升35%。
(二)需求管理:避免"越改越亂"的關(guān)鍵防線(xiàn)
需求變更堪稱(chēng)研發(fā)團(tuán)隊(duì)的"噩夢(mèng)"。據(jù)統(tǒng)計(jì),60%的項(xiàng)目延期源于需求頻繁變動(dòng)。有效的需求管理需建立"評(píng)審-確認(rèn)-跟蹤"機(jī)制:需求提出時(shí),組織產(chǎn)品、開(kāi)發(fā)、測(cè)試三方評(píng)審,評(píng)估實(shí)現(xiàn)難度與成本;確認(rèn)后通過(guò)需求跟蹤矩陣(RTM)記錄每個(gè)需求的開(kāi)發(fā)狀態(tài)、測(cè)試結(jié)果;變更時(shí)需重新評(píng)估影響范圍,避免"改一個(gè)功能,亂整個(gè)系統(tǒng)"。某物流軟件公司通過(guò)嚴(yán)格的需求管理,將需求變更導(dǎo)致的延期率從52%降至18%。
(三)代碼質(zhì)量:決定軟件"生命力"的隱形基因
代碼質(zhì)量直接影響軟件的可維護(hù)性、擴(kuò)展性和穩(wěn)定性。實(shí)踐中,企業(yè)可通過(guò)"工具+制度"雙管齊下:使用SonarQube等靜態(tài)代碼分析工具,自動(dòng)檢測(cè)代碼重復(fù)、安全漏洞等問(wèn)題;建立代碼審查制度,要求開(kāi)發(fā)者提交代碼前進(jìn)行同行評(píng)審,確保符合編碼規(guī)范;引入單元測(cè)試框架(如JUnit),強(qiáng)制要求關(guān)鍵功能測(cè)試覆蓋率不低于80%。某游戲開(kāi)發(fā)公司實(shí)施代碼質(zhì)量管控后,線(xiàn)上故障次數(shù)減少60%,維護(hù)成本降低40%。
(四)風(fēng)險(xiǎn)管理:把"未知"變成"可控"
風(fēng)險(xiǎn)管理需貫穿研發(fā)全周期。啟動(dòng)階段,通過(guò)SWOT分析識(shí)別技術(shù)、人員、市場(chǎng)等風(fēng)險(xiǎn);開(kāi)發(fā)階段,定期更新風(fēng)險(xiǎn)登記冊(cè),評(píng)估風(fēng)險(xiǎn)發(fā)生概率與影響程度;上線(xiàn)前,針對(duì)高風(fēng)險(xiǎn)項(xiàng)進(jìn)行專(zhuān)項(xiàng)測(cè)試(如壓力測(cè)試、容災(zāi)演練)。某銀行核心系統(tǒng)升級(jí)項(xiàng)目中,團(tuán)隊(duì)提前識(shí)別出"舊數(shù)據(jù)遷移失敗"風(fēng)險(xiǎn),通過(guò)搭建模擬環(huán)境預(yù)演遷移過(guò)程,最終成功避免了上線(xiàn)后的數(shù)據(jù)混亂問(wèn)題。
四、工具賦能:軟件研發(fā)管理平臺(tái)如何提升效率?
隨著研發(fā)規(guī)模擴(kuò)大,僅靠人工管理難以應(yīng)對(duì)復(fù)雜需求,專(zhuān)業(yè)的研發(fā)管理平臺(tái)成為"剛需"。這類(lèi)工具通常具備以下功能:
- 全流程可視化:通過(guò)甘特圖、燃盡圖等工具,實(shí)時(shí)展示項(xiàng)目進(jìn)度、任務(wù)分配、資源使用情況,管理者可一目了然掌握全局;
- 協(xié)作一體化:集成需求管理、代碼托管(如GitLab)、測(cè)試管理(如TestRail)、文檔共享等功能,避免團(tuán)隊(duì)切換多個(gè)工具導(dǎo)致的效率損耗;
- 數(shù)據(jù)驅(qū)動(dòng)決策:自動(dòng)生成研發(fā)效能報(bào)告(如代碼提交頻率、缺陷修復(fù)周期),為流程優(yōu)化、人員考核提供數(shù)據(jù)支撐;
- 風(fēng)險(xiǎn)預(yù)警:設(shè)置任務(wù)超時(shí)、測(cè)試覆蓋率不達(dá)標(biāo)等預(yù)警規(guī)則,系統(tǒng)自動(dòng)推送提醒,幫助團(tuán)隊(duì)提前干預(yù)。
以某制造企業(yè)為例,其研發(fā)團(tuán)隊(duì)使用管理平臺(tái)后,需求傳遞錯(cuò)誤率下降50%,測(cè)試用例執(zhí)行效率提升3倍,項(xiàng)目交付周期平均縮短25%。
五、體系建設(shè):從"零散管理"到"長(zhǎng)效機(jī)制"的進(jìn)階路徑
構(gòu)建成熟的研發(fā)管理體系并非一蹴而就,需分階段推進(jìn):
- 基礎(chǔ)搭建期(1-3個(gè)月):明確團(tuán)隊(duì)角色分工,制定基礎(chǔ)流程(如需求評(píng)審、代碼提交規(guī)范),引入輕量級(jí)工具(如Trello)管理任務(wù);
- 優(yōu)化迭代期(3-6個(gè)月):通過(guò)數(shù)據(jù)分析識(shí)別流程瓶頸(如測(cè)試環(huán)節(jié)耗時(shí)過(guò)長(zhǎng)),針對(duì)性?xún)?yōu)化(如引入自動(dòng)化測(cè)試工具),升級(jí)管理平臺(tái)(如使用Jira);
- 文化形成期(6個(gè)月以上):將管理規(guī)范融入團(tuán)隊(duì)日常工作,通過(guò)培訓(xùn)、案例分享提升成員認(rèn)知,形成"主動(dòng)規(guī)劃、透明協(xié)作、持續(xù)改進(jìn)"的研發(fā)文化。
值得注意的是,管理體系需與企業(yè)業(yè)務(wù)特點(diǎn)匹配。初創(chuàng)公司更關(guān)注靈活性,可側(cè)重敏捷開(kāi)發(fā);大型企業(yè)需兼顧規(guī)范與效率,可采用"敏捷+DevOps"的混合模式。
結(jié)語(yǔ):軟件研發(fā)管理是"技術(shù)力"的*放大器
在技術(shù)迭代加速、市場(chǎng)競(jìng)爭(zhēng)白熱化的今天,軟件研發(fā)已從"成本中心"轉(zhuǎn)變?yōu)?價(jià)值中心"。而軟件研發(fā)管理,正是將技術(shù)能力轉(zhuǎn)化為業(yè)務(wù)價(jià)值的關(guān)鍵橋梁。無(wú)論是解決資源浪費(fèi)、信息孤島等痛點(diǎn),還是通過(guò)流程優(yōu)化、工具賦能提升效率,其核心目標(biāo)都是讓"開(kāi)發(fā)過(guò)程更可控,交付成果更可靠"。對(duì)于企業(yè)而言,重視研發(fā)管理不是選擇題,而是必須掌握的"生存技能"——唯有如此,才能在數(shù)字時(shí)代的競(jìng)爭(zhēng)中占據(jù)先機(jī)。
轉(zhuǎn)載:http://runho.cn/zixun_detail/522903.html